#1ee180 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1ee180 is composed of 11.8% red, 88.2%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 43.1%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 150.2 degrees, a saturation of 76.5% and a lightness of 50%. #1ee180 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cffff with #00c301.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

#1ee180 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1ee180 has RGB values of R:30, G:225,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0, Y:0.43,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 2023808.
